Should Have Known!
I love A.S. King. She is just such a neat, original, brilliant writer. I started Me and Marvin Gardens without realizing that it was written by A.S. King. Now I know why, as I look at the cover! It has her full name! Yeah, I guess I should have figured it out, but I didn't until I saw it listed under A.S. King on goodreads! Ha! Well when I started this book I loved it right away and I could tell that it was more than a middle grade novel. It is weird, it is deep, it is awesome. Now this has to be a Newbery contender!

Sucked Me Right In...but then got too complicated :(
I am an easy kinda reader. Political thrillers can be too much for me. Same with the legal thrillers. I like easy. Maybe I am lazy, maybe I am just not that smart. Probably a combination of both. Daughter of Deep Silence was great, it was. It starts out very exciting and keeps on being very exciting, but then...it just gets too complicated for me...well, the end does. I mean the "reveal" was too complicated. The descriptions of Frances' passion for Gray were a little too Harlequin for me, too. But over all, this was worth the read. Totally different from The Forest of Hands and Teeth series. Totally. But I liked it just the same!
